Citi in Belfast seeks a Securities & Derivatives Analyst to process orders and transactions for traders. This role involves engaging with clients and vendors while resolving issues. Ideal candidates will possess relevant experience and work well in a high-risk fast-paced environment.

Citi offers a hybrid working model and benefits including:

  • 27 days holiday
  • Performance bonuses
  • Medical insurance
  • And more
